I grew up in Teaneck. I fished Overpeck Park/creek several times. Duffman is correct, white perch. There are also carp and some catfish (not many) in there. Used to be a decent place for crabbing-believe it or not. Never once did I ever see shad in there.

Overpeck Creek is a branch of the Hackensack River and that part of the river is is tidal so it might be possible for schoolie stripers to be up that far (they catch stripers not to far downriver from there).

FYI, used to be a good place to trap killies, wonder if it still is.
